The really cool thing about this tip is that Google local listings appear at the very top of the search engine listings, so it's a great shortcut to SEO...Not perhaps very effective if you live somewhere with lots of VAs, but good if you're in a fairly local market!

I did mine the other day through the company that made my website and now I come up fifth on the first page! Only downside is that they had my company name wrong so I have to wait 2 - 3 weeks for a postcard with a pin on it to confirm I am who I say I am. So make sure your details are correct when you fill it all in!
